Andy Serkis

English actor and director, motion capture pioneer
Born
April 20th, 1964 60 years ago

An English actor and director, contributions to the film industry include pioneering motion capture technology. Gained recognition for performances in 'The Lord of the Rings' trilogy as Gollum and in 'Planet of the Apes' as Caesar. His directorial work includes 'Breathe' and the adaptation of 'The Jungle Book'.

Gianandrea Noseda

Italian conductor and pianist
Born
April 23rd, 1964 60 years ago

A prominent figure in classical music, this conductor gained recognition for leadership roles with several notable orchestras. Distinguished work includes positions as Music Director of the National Symphony Orchestra and Principal Guest Conductor of the London Symphony Orchestra. Conducted acclaimed performances at prestigious venues such as the BBC Proms and the Salzburg Festival. This individual also has made significant contributions to opera, conducting productions at major opera houses including La Scala and the Royal Opera House.

Djimon Hounsou

Actor and producer in film industry
Born
April 24th, 1964 60 years ago

Born in Benin, a successful career in acting developed in America after moving in the early 1990s. Gained international recognition through standout performances in films such as 'Blood Diamond,' 'In America,' and 'Gladiator.' Achievements in the film industry include multiple award nominations and wins, showcasing talent in both dramatic and action roles. A notable producer, worked on several projects that highlight African narratives.

Cedric the Entertainer

Comedian and actor from 'The Original Kings of Comedy'
Born
April 24th, 1964 60 years ago

A prominent comedian and actor, contributions spanned stand-up comedy, television, and film. Rose to fame with performances in 'The Original Kings of Comedy' and featured in the sitcom 'The Steve Harvey Show'. Served as a producer on several projects, including 'Cedric the Entertainer Presents'. Hosted various award shows and specials, showcasing a blend of humor and charisma. Established a strong presence in various entertainment mediums and earned recognition for work in both comedy and acting.

Andy Bell

English singer-songwriter with Erasure
Born
April 25th, 1964 60 years ago

A prominent figure in music, this singer-songwriter co-founded the synth-pop duo Erasure in the mid-1980s. The band gained widespread acclaim for their catchy melodies and distinctive sound, becoming a significant part of the UK music scene. They released several successful albums, including 'Wonderland' and 'Chorus,' and produced numerous hit singles such as 'A Little Respect' and 'Chains of Love.' In addition to work with Erasure, this artist also pursued a solo career, contributing to various musical projects and collaborations. The influence on electronic music remains evident, with a dedicated fanbase that spans multiple generations. Achievements include numerous chart-topping hits and several UK music awards.

Hank Azaria

Actor and voice artist from The Simpsons
Born
April 25th, 1964 60 years ago

An American actor, voice artist, comedian, and producer, this individual gained prominence through work in television and film. Recognition includes multiple Emmy Awards for voice performances on the animated series 'The Simpsons', where numerous characters, such as Moe Szyslak and Apu Nahasapeemapetilon, were voiced. Additionally, work in various films contributed to a successful career in both comedy and drama, showcasing versatility across different genres.

Stephen Ames

Trinidadian professional golfer
Born
April 28th, 1964 60 years ago

A professional golfer from Trinidad, played on the PGA Tour and Champions Tour. Achieved significant success in the early 2000s and gained recognition for winning the 2006 Players Championship, one of the most prestigious events in golf. Established a noteworthy career with multiple victories, showcasing skills in putting and strategic course management.

Noriyuki Iwadare

Japanese composer of video game music
Born
April 28th, 1964 60 years ago

A prominent composer in the video game industry, this individual contributed significantly to the scores of various games. Starting in the late 1980s, compositions include works for the Lunar series and Grandia. Recognized for blending orchestral and electronic elements, the music enhanced the narrative experience of the games. Collaborations with various video game developers showcased a distinctive style that resonated with fans around the world.
